So, what is l-askorbiinihappo?
L-askorbiinihappo is a Finnish term for a naturally occurring organic compound, also known as L-ascorbic acid or vitamin C. It is an essential nutrient for human health and plays a crucial role in collagen synthesis, immune system function, and iron absorption. L-askorbiinihappo is commonly found in fruits and vegetables, but it can also be used as a food additive to prevent oxidation and preserve freshness. Due to its antioxidant properties, L-askorbiinihappo is often added to processed foods, beverages, and supplements to boost their nutritional value and shelf life.
